Shepherds Port, Bear Lake now showing very good signs as catch rates up week on week, the 18lb carp which had not shown for over a year was caught in a strong midweek session along with a 12lb and a 10lb fish. also plenty of 4 pound plus fish showing along with plenty of silvers when fished for. Pellet and corn finding the better fish all methods working well. Shepherds lake continue to fish well with good catches reported from all around the lake, this year the tench are showing more frequently, also the crucians are putting in plenty of appearances. Carp continue to feed strongly supported by the big shoals of bream. nets over 60lb reported throughout the week.
